다음을 통해 공유


PipelineJob interface

파이프라인 작업 정의: 제네릭에서 MFE 특성으로 정의합니다.

Extends

속성

inputs

파이프라인 작업에 대한 입력입니다.

jobs

작업은 파이프라인 작업을 생성합니다.

jobType

이 개체가 될 수 있는 다양한 형식을 지정하는 다형 판별자

outputs

파이프라인 작업에 대한 출력

settings

ContinueRunOnStepFailure 등의 파이프라인 설정

sourceJobId

원본 작업의 ARM 리소스 ID입니다.

상속된 속성

componentId

구성 요소 리소스의 ARM 리소스 ID입니다.

computeId

컴퓨팅 리소스의 ARM 리소스 ID입니다.

description

자산 설명 텍스트입니다.

displayName

작업의 표시 이름입니다.

experimentName

작업이 속한 실험의 이름입니다. 설정하지 않으면 작업이 "기본" 실험에 배치됩니다.

identity

ID 구성. 설정된 경우 AmlToken, ManagedIdentity, UserIdentity 또는 null 중 하나여야 합니다. null인 경우 기본값은 AmlToken입니다.

isArchived

자산이 보관되어 있나요?

properties

자산 속성 사전입니다.

services

JobEndpoints 목록입니다. 로컬 작업의 경우 작업 엔드포인트의 엔드포인트 값은 FileStreamObject입니다.

status

작업의 상태. 참고: 이 속성은 serialize되지 않습니다. 서버에서만 채울 수 있습니다.

tags

태그 사전. 태그를 추가, 제거 및 업데이트할 수 있습니다.

속성 세부 정보

inputs

파이프라인 작업에 대한 입력입니다.

inputs?: {[propertyName: string]: JobInputUnion | null}

속성 값

{[propertyName: string]: JobInputUnion | null}

jobs

작업은 파이프라인 작업을 생성합니다.

jobs?: {[propertyName: string]: Record<string, unknown>}

속성 값

{[propertyName: string]: Record<string, unknown>}

jobType

이 개체가 될 수 있는 다양한 형식을 지정하는 다형 판별자

jobType: "Pipeline"

속성 값

"Pipeline"

outputs

파이프라인 작업에 대한 출력

outputs?: {[propertyName: string]: JobOutputUnion | null}

속성 값

{[propertyName: string]: JobOutputUnion | null}

settings

ContinueRunOnStepFailure 등의 파이프라인 설정

settings?: Record<string, unknown>

속성 값

Record<string, unknown>

sourceJobId

원본 작업의 ARM 리소스 ID입니다.

sourceJobId?: string

속성 값

string

상속된 속성 세부 정보

componentId

구성 요소 리소스의 ARM 리소스 ID입니다.

componentId?: string

속성 값

string

JobBaseProperties.componentId에서 상속됨

computeId

컴퓨팅 리소스의 ARM 리소스 ID입니다.

computeId?: string

속성 값

string

JobBaseProperties.computeId에서 상속됨

description

자산 설명 텍스트입니다.

description?: string

속성 값

string

JobBaseProperties.description에서 상속됨

displayName

작업의 표시 이름입니다.

displayName?: string

속성 값

string

JobBaseProperties.displayName에서 상속됨

experimentName

작업이 속한 실험의 이름입니다. 설정하지 않으면 작업이 "기본" 실험에 배치됩니다.

experimentName?: string

속성 값

string

JobBaseProperties.experimentName에서 상속됨

identity

ID 구성. 설정된 경우 AmlToken, ManagedIdentity, UserIdentity 또는 null 중 하나여야 합니다. null인 경우 기본값은 AmlToken입니다.

identity?: IdentityConfigurationUnion

속성 값

JobBaseProperties.identity에서 상속

isArchived

자산이 보관되어 있나요?

isArchived?: boolean

속성 값

boolean

JobBaseProperties.isArchived에서 상속

properties

자산 속성 사전입니다.

properties?: {[propertyName: string]: string | null}

속성 값

{[propertyName: string]: string | null}

JobBaseProperties.properties에서 상속됨

services

JobEndpoints 목록입니다. 로컬 작업의 경우 작업 엔드포인트의 엔드포인트 값은 FileStreamObject입니다.

services?: {[propertyName: string]: JobService | null}

속성 값

{[propertyName: string]: JobService | null}

JobBaseProperties.services에서 상속

status

작업의 상태. 참고: 이 속성은 serialize되지 않습니다. 서버에서만 채울 수 있습니다.

status?: string

속성 값

string

JobBaseProperties.status에서 상속됨

tags

태그 사전. 태그를 추가, 제거 및 업데이트할 수 있습니다.

tags?: {[propertyName: string]: string | null}

속성 값

{[propertyName: string]: string | null}

JobBaseProperties.tags에서 상속